更新时间:2024-09-12 GMT+08:00
分享

设置GaussDB(for MySQL)标准版同区域备份策略

操作场景

创建GaussDB(for MySQL)标准版实例时,系统默认开启自动备份策略,出于安全考虑,实例创建成功后不可关闭。您可根据业务需要设置自动备份策略,GaussDB(for MySQL)标准版按照您设置的自动备份策略对数据库进行备份。

GaussDB(for MySQL)标准版的备份操作是实例级的,而不是数据库级的。当数据库故障或数据损坏时,可以通过备份恢复数据库,从而保证数据可靠性。备份以压缩包的形式存储在对象存储服务上,以保证用户数据的机密性和持久性。由于开启备份会损耗数据库读写性能,建议您选择业务低峰时间段设置自动备份。

设置自动备份策略后,会按照策略中的备份时间段和备份周期进行全量备份。实例在执行备份时,按照策略中的保留天数进行存放,备份时长和实例的数据量有关。

在进行全量备份的同时系统每5分钟会自动生成增量备份,用户不需要设置。生成的增量备份可以用来将数据恢复到指定时间点。

  • 自动备份的备份文件不支持手动删除,可通过修改自动备份策略调整备份保留天数,超出备份保留天数的已有备份文件会被自动删除。
  • GaussDB(for MySQL)标准版实例备份保留天数默认为7天,用户可通过修改自动备份策略自行修改。

未开启CBR备份的约束限制

  • 备机故障、备机复制时延超过240s的高可用实例,备份会到主机上执行。
  • 当数据库实例被删除时,实例的自动备份将被同步删除,手动备份不会被删除。
  • 全量备份时不允许重启数据库,请谨慎选择备份时间段。
  • 全量备份时,会连接备份所属的实例,校验该实例的状态。如果校验存在以下两种情况,则校验不通过,会自动进行校验重试。如果重试结束后,仍然无法满足,则备份失败。
    • 备份所属的实例正在执行DDL操作。
    • 从备份所属的实例获取备份锁失败。
  • 全量备份会占用节点资源,尤其是磁盘带宽。可能会导致实例吞吐量下降,复制时延等问题。

开启CBR备份的约束限制

  • 备份时长与实例数据量大小成正比,如果数据量较大,可联系客服开通CBR快照备份功能提高备份速率。
  • 开启CBR备份后,备份策略为快照备份,已有的自动备份和手动备份的恢复功能正常使用。
  • 开启CBR备份后,当数据库实例被删除时,实例的自动备份将被同步删除,手动备份不会被删除。
  • 实例在进行CBR快照备份时,不支持下发DDL操作,如果有正在执行的DDL操作,会在DDL操作结束后再进行快照备份。
  • 开启CBR备份后,下一次生成的全量备份为快照备份,使用该备份进行恢复,为CBR快照恢复。

查看或修改自动备份策略

  1. 登录管理控制台
  2. 单击管理控制台左上角的,选择区域和项目。
  3. 单击页面左上角的,选择“数据库 > 云数据库 RDS”,进入RDS信息页面。
  4. “实例管理”页面,选择指定的实例,单击实例名称。
  5. 在左侧导航栏,单击“备份恢复”
  6. 单击“同区域备份策略”

    您可以查看到已设置的备份策略,如需修改备份策略,请调整以下参数的值。

    表1 参数说明

    参数名称

    说明

    备份时间段

    默认为24小时中,间隔一小时的随机的一个时间段 ,例如01:00~02:00,12:00~13:00等。备份时间段并不是指整个备份任务完成的时间,指的是备份的开始时间,备份时长和实例的数据量有关。

    建议根据业务情况,选择业务低峰时段。备份时间段以UTC时区保存。如果碰到夏令时/冬令时切换,备份时间段会因时区变化而改变。

    备份周期

    默认全选,可修改,且至少选择一周中的1天。

    自动备份保留天数(天)

    保留天数为全量自动备份和Binlog备份的保留时长,默认为7天,范围为1~732天。

    • 增加保留天数,可提升数据可靠性,请根据需要设置。
    • 减少保留天数,会针对已有的备份文件生效,但手动备份不会自动删除,请您谨慎选择。

    全量备份文件自动删除策略

    考虑到数据完整性,自动删除时仍然会保留最近的一次超过保留天数的全量备份,保证在保留天数内的数据可正常恢复。

    假如备份周期选择“周一”、“周二”,保留天数设置为“2”,备份文件的删除策略如下:

    • 本周一产生的全量备份,会在本周四当天自动删除。原因如下:

      本周二的全量备份在本周四当天超过保留天数,按照全量备份文件自动删除策略,会保留最近的一个超过保留天数的全量备份(即本周二的备份会被保留),因此周四当天删除本周一产生的全量备份文件。

    • 本周二产生的全量备份,会在下周三当天自动删除。原因如下:

      下周一产生的全量备份在下周三超过保留天数,按照全量备份文件自动删除策略,会保留最近的一个超过保留天数的全量备份(即下周一的备份会被保留),因此下周三当天删除本周二产生的全量备份。

  7. 单击“确定”。

相关文档